In Short
Patrons walk in the restaurant and immediately go up the stairs to the contemporary-style second and third floor, where they enjoy superior views of the harbor. The menu at this sleek-looking restaurant features such seafood-with-flair items as lobster mashed potatoes, pan-seared rockfish and Asian barbecue salmon. Items that didn't come from the sea include filet mignon and chicken marsala. Live piano music helps set a relaxed yet festive mood at dinnertime.
